Not if the Republicans want to win in 2024. Trump has lost the independent vote. The Republican Party is still the smaller of the two major parties, it's a must to win independents or lose the election. Independents put Trump into the White House in 2016 going for him 46-42 over Hillary with 12% voting third party against both major party candidates. In 2020 Independents went for Biden 54-41 over Trump. After four years of Trump's childish antics like name calling and throwing temper tantrums, his third grade schoolyard bullying tactics, independents said enough is enough. They just plain tired of him and his very unpresidential behavior. Even after a four year absents in 2024, independents aren't going to return to him. One needs to realize even though Independents went for Trump in 2016, 54% didn't. Either opting to vote for Hillary or against Hillary and Trump. So no, not if the republicans want to win.
